Zoning Case Hearing Begins with James Family's Proposal in Fort Worth
The Benbrook Planning and Zoning Commission kicked off its meeting on June 26, 2025, with a clear focus on maintaining an orderly public hearing process. The chair emphasized the importance of allowing community members to voice their opinions, stating, “This is your opportunity to be heard on the item.”

The meeting began with a presentation from city staff, followed by an invitation for public comments. Attendees were encouraged to express their views, with the chair reminding them to limit their remarks to three minutes to ensure everyone had a chance to speak.

Travis Clegg, representing Westwood Professional Services, introduced himself as the consultant for the James family regarding a proposed zoning case. This marks a significant step in the ongoing development discussions in Benbrook, as the commission prepares to deliberate on the zoning request after hearing from both supporters and opponents.

As the meeting progresses, the commission will consider the public input before making a decision, highlighting the importance of community engagement in local governance. The outcome of this zoning case could have lasting implications for the area, making it a key topic for residents to follow closely.
